A Straightforward Diastereoselective Synthesis of trans-Linalyl Oxide by an Intramolecular SN2′ Reaction

An intramolecular SN2′ cyclization using 6, 7-dihydroxyneryl N-phenylcarbamate and zinc iodide affords the trans-linalyl oxide in good yield and high diastereomeric excess.
